Ep 1, S5, How did Harley-Davidson clean BMW's clock?  Interview with Executive Editor of Cycle World Magazine, Justin Dawes

Cycle World Magazine made some serious waves last month when they released an Article Entitled 2021 Big Bore Adventure Shootout and declared the Harley-Davidson Pan America as the top Adventure Bike, displacing the BMW R1250 GS. In this episode of Behind the Bars, Mark and John interview Executive Editor on the reasons why the magazine chose the Pan America.  

So much so that the Editor himself has received some hate mail because of the article.  How could the new kid on the block show up on year one and knock BMW out of the top spot?  Read the article.

Ep 7, S3, Discussion regarding Harley's Controversial partnership with Chinese Motorcycle Manufacturer Qianjiang Motorcycle Group

Ep 7, S3, Discussion regarding Harley's Controversial partnership with Chinese Motorcycle Manufacturer Qianjiang Motorcycle Group

Ep 7, S3, Discussion regarding Harley's Partnership with Chinese Motorcycle Manufacturer Qianjiang Motorcycle Group

In this podcast, John and Mark chat with Robert Pandya, (former PR Manager for Aprilia, Motoguzzi, Victory and Indian) about Harley-Davidson’s recent controversial announcement.  HD has partnered with a Chinese motorcycling manufacturer Qianjiang Motorcycle Group to begin producing smaller (338 cc) and more accessible bikes for the Asian Market.  

Robert is perhaps the most energetic ambassador for the motorcycle industry that we know  He is tireless in his determination to build riders.  Tune in to hear why he thinks this is a great move for the Harley-Davidson Motor Company.

Jody Reinisch, Mayor of Ryder, North Dakota

Jody Reinisch, Mayor of Ryder, North Dakota

Mark and John interview the Mayor of North Dakota. Why? Well, you may have seen the town of Ryder in the news. Harley-Davidson decided to help turn the entire town of Ryder into a town of Motorcycle Riders by training everyone on how to ride a Harley using Riding Academy. Interesting story on the behind of the scenes on how Harley-Davidson really is focused on building riders for the future.
